ܐܣܛܕܝܐ

Etymology

[edit]

Learned borrowing from Classical Syriac, from Ancient Greek στᾰ́δῐον (stádion).

Pronunciation

[edit]
  • (Standard) IPA(key): [ʔɪs.tað.jɑː]

Noun

[edit]

ܐܸܣܛܲܕ݂ܝܵܐ (isṭaḏyām sg (plural ܐܸܣ̈ܛܕܵܘܵܬ݂ܹܐ (isṭdāwāṯē))

  1. stadium, arena (venue where sporting events are held)
    Synonym: ܒܹܝܬ݂ ܐܸܫܬܥܸܢܝܵܐ (bēṯ ištˁinyā)
  2. stade, stadion (former Greek unit of distance; about 196 metres in Mesopotamia)
